Animal Care Associates is a full-service animal hospital and boarding facility that has been treating pets in the Charleston, WV area since 1984. We set a standard for excellent veterinary care that is unsurpassed. In fact, we are the only veterinarians in the Charleston area accredited by the American Animal Hospital Association. We offer a variety of services including wellness exams, surgery, in-house diagnostics, dentistry, digital radiography, ultrasound, laser therapy, and much more.
At our practice, we treat more than just cats and dogs. We are a leading veterinary care provider in the area for birds we well as exotic and pocket pets. We see uncommon companion animals like birds, lizards, snakes, sugar gliders, and hedgehogs as well as more common pocket pets like rabbits, hamsters, and ferrets.

Job duties include, but are not limited to:
Animal restraint, triage of incoming patients, collection and analysis of lab samples, diagnostic imaging, management and nursing care of medical and hospitalized cases with varying degrees of stability, administration of medications, effective communication of treatment plans with clients, surgical preparation and assistance, and anesthetic management.
Must be able to withstand unpleasant odors and noises. May be exposed to bites, scratches, animal waste and potentially contagious diseases.
